Scarlet elfcup (Sarcoscypha coccinea)
Scarlet elfcup (Sarcoscypha coccinea)
A vivid splash of colour at a dull time of year: the scarlet elfcup can be found growing on rotten, fallen branches in damp, shady woods through winter and spring.
